About Westover Club Neighborhood
Westover Club sits in the Thornebrooke Elementary corridor of Windermere, off Westover Roberts Road and just east of South Apopka Vineland Road. The neighborhood was developed primarily during the early 2000s as a gated community of custom-built single-family homes, and that era of Windermere construction is reflected in the lot sizes and architectural variety — most homes sit on parcels of roughly 0.30 acres or larger, with stucco-and-tile Mediterranean and traditional Florida elevations rather than the production-builder uniformity common in newer master-planned communities.
Homes typically offer 4 to 6 bedrooms with square footage in the 2,300 to 4,500 range, and many include screened pools, three-car garages, and outdoor living spaces oriented to take advantage of Florida's climate. Because the community matured over more than two decades, the tree canopy is well-established, and street-level character is meaningfully different from new construction nearby.
Westover Club is identified in our hub data as one of the area's established gated golf communities, alongside flagships like Isleworth and Keene's Pointe — though Westover Club operates at a more accessible price point and on a more intimate community scale. Internal amenities include a community pool, tennis courts, basketball and volleyball courts, and a playground; the gated entry is the defining security feature.

Westover Club Location & Connections
Westover Club is positioned in the Thornebrooke corridor of central Windermere, with primary access via Westover Roberts Road. South Apopka Vineland Road provides the main arterial connection west toward Disney and east toward Dr. Phillips, while Conroy-Windermere Road and the SR-429 / Florida's Turnpike interchange handle longer commutes.

Westover Club Amenities & Lifestyle
Day-to-day life in Westover Club is built around a self-contained amenity package — a community pool, tennis courts, basketball and volleyball courts, and a playground — combined with central Windermere access to Windermere's shopping, dining, parks, and lakes. The neighborhood's location in the Thornebrooke Elementary corridor places it within a 5–10 minute drive of The Grove at Isleworth, Town Square, and the Butler Chain of Lakes, making it well-suited to families who want established character without sacrificing access to area amenities.

Westover Club HOA & CDD Information
Westover Club is governed by a homeowners association that maintains the gated entry, common areas, and shared amenities (pool, tennis and multi-sport courts, and playground). The community is not believed to carry a Community Development District (CDD) assessment — a meaningful difference from many newer Horizon West and southwest Orange County master-planned communities — but buyers should always confirm CDD status through their title commitment at closing.
